Ball screw repair follows 6 essential principles which include lubrication, examination of the ball screw’s initial condition, extensive cleaning, rebuilding the ball screw assembly, extended testing, and refurbishing.

All manner of high-tech industries are making use of ball screw technology. Because of the technical nature of these industries, ball screw components need to be regularly maintained and subjected to ball screw repair to ensure optimum performance and to troubleshoot failures. Although there might be varied causes of ball screw failures there are essential principles in repairing them. It is important to understand these principles to better know how ball screw repair is undertaken.

Lubricating

A poor surface finish and routine wear are two of the most common resaons of ball screw failure. The failure occurs when continuous contact between the hard surface of the ball screw shaft and the re-circulation ball screw surface. Given enough time, the surface of the ball screw will succumb to wear and tear. The lubrication is present to both repair this specific problem and also helps the ball screw function correctly and make it last longer. A vital part is to choose the lubricant that best suits the component’s conditions. It is vital to avoid over-lubricating, as it can add up to pressure on the ball nut return system and, ultimately, cause the tube to burst from too much grease.

Inspecting the primary status of the ball screw

Consider the ball screw’s condition before beginning repairs. Consider free-running condition and drag torque to follow this principle. The ball screw is also subjected to a health check focused on the main points that contribute to optimum ball screw performance. This principle is necessary to determine whether the ball screw is still in repairable condition.

Extensive cleaning

Until you clean the ball screw, you can’t continue fixing it. Longitudinal course of the ball screw is initially rubbed and for clearing accrued oil and dust ultrasonic scrubbing and above-normal pressure cleansing is done on it.

Reconstructing the ball screw unit

Take note that micron-graded precision bearings which are extra large are recreated on the assembly of bsll screw. The pre-load level, conforming to DIN standards, is achievable through these means.

Unlike trying to sell so many other products, trying to sell a used vehicle can be very tricky. With so many things that a person needs to be aware of and with so many dealerships offering warranties and guaranties of quality, selling a used car on your own can be a major feat. So what are some of the best techniques for selling a used car on your own? When we get right down to it, there are really only about four main areas to consider when deciding to put a used car up for sale privately.

For most people when looking at so many cars available from both private owners and dealers the two most important factors that are considered first are the reliability and safety of the vehicle. Truth be known, almost anyone who has ever bought a used car has stories of used cars that they bought where shortly after the purchase they began to experience mechanical failures. If you are smart, before putting any vehicle up for sale it would be a good idea to have the vehicle serviced. At the very least you should have it checked independently for any obvious faults, particularly those that might be considered issues with the safety of the vehicle.

Next and most obvious you need to make sure that the vehicle being sold is roadworthy. In most areas around the country and in the Used Cars Cincinnati area where I am from, this is usually determined by the fact that it has a valid Ministry of Transport (MOT) certificate. If this is not available, it is the responsibility of the seller to make this known before selling the vehicle. If this is not disclosed, it is possible to be prosecuted if it can be proven that a vehicle was sold with prior knowledge of a dangerous condition.

The third aspect that is most often considered is the sale price of the vehicle. This is where your own personal selling technique has to be refined because no matter how good your techniques may be, they will never be successful if the price you are asking is way out of line with the fair market value for the vehicle. In the Cincinnati Used Cars market especially where there is a lot of competition for selling used cars, it is vitally important that you gauge the market and price your vehicle at the right margin level to make yourself competitive. This is why it is important to do some research in order to determine what might be a realistic price to attract potential purchasers?

The final factor to consider is that you need to put yourself in the shoes of the buyer where you would not want to be told false or misleading information so you should not make misleading statements about the vehicle being sold or misrepresent to the buyer in any way. Once you have reviewed this information and taken action on what has been outlined above the next step is to discuss the best methods for selling the car.

There are so many ways to sell your car and like most of us your going to be anxious for a quick sale, but the best way to guarantee yourself the most profit is simply through your own efforts rather than taking short cuts and giving up some of your profit by taking it to a dealer or part-exchanging it for another. Experience has shown that one of the most common and generally successful methods for selling your car is to advertise in your local paper. As long as you put the effort into creating an ad that stands out when advertising with so many others, it is possible to get it sold in a matter of a few days. If you consider peoples buying habits and place your ad on a Friday, this allows people the weekend to look at the car and should increase the odds of having a higher number of interested parties giving a higher prospect of getting the price that you want.

Cars a few decades ago could only take you from one place to another but many of today’s vehicles utilize sophisticated computer technology and are extremely advanced. Some of the vehicle’s on the automotive market are already using systems which can detect driving behavior which deviates from the driver’s normal driving behavior possibly indicating drowsiness and fatigue. Volvo offers Pedestrian Detection Technology which brakes on its own if detects a passenger in front of the car. BMW uses a camera system called Night Vision which helps warns drivers of an impending collision via infrared cameras.

One company that has been working hard in order to further advanced vehicle technology is Ford. The company has assembled a task ford of experts who will combine forces in order to build a system that will allow one car to actually communicate with another. First they will need to create a common language that all vehicles will use in order to communicate. Two vehicles will be donated by Ford in order to further this project.
